In November 2015, Volskwagen unveiled the Golf GTI VII Clubsport at the Portimao circuit in Portugal. The model was intended for commercialization in 2016 for the 40th anniversary of the GTI. Various mechanical and chassis modifications made the car particularly performing, with a power of 265hp delivered by the 2-liter turbo engine, which with the Overboost function could reach 290. One year later the Clubsport S version arrived, whose power increased to 310hp. that is a dozen more than the Golf VII R. At the wheel of a Clubsport S, Volkswagen driver Benjamin Leuchter broke the record at the Nurburgring in the front-wheel drive category, lapping in 7'49 "21 and reaching a top speed of 265 km / h.
